In the fifth year of Tiancheng, in 930 AD, Ma Yin, the founding monarch of Southern Chu, died of illness.

Seventy-nine when he died, a difference of one year to eighty.

Looking back on this life, there are sighs and touches, and overall it is not bad.

Southern Chu under the governance of Ma Yin, well-developed and thriving, he is not a lawless king, he does not like to kill ministers, he is not a war maniac, he does not like to take the initiative to provoke wars, but he has adopted the strategy of "serving the five generations of Zhengshuo, and serving the people and the people", focusing on protecting the territory and the people.

On the water side of Hengyang, Ma Yin slept here, leaving the foundation to his son Ma Xisheng.

This Ma Xisheng, originally he couldn't take over the shift, the reason is very simple, he is Ma Yin's second son.

In the era when the primogeniture inheritance system is the mainstream, the fate of the second son is often destined, the second son, that is, there is no hope, if there is hope, Taizong Li Shimin will not be blood-spattered Xuanwumen.

Ma Xisheng was able to inherit Nanchu as his second son, thanks to his mother Concubine De.

Concubine De is the favorite concubine of the old man Ma Yin, Ma Yin loves the house and Wu, and when she changed her mind, she left the inheritance to Concubine De's son.

When people are old, they are inevitably confused, and the eldest son Ma Xizhen is known as virtuous, but he missed the throne.

But come to think of it, Ma Xizhen shouldn't care, he himself doesn't have much pursuit of power, his biggest hobby in life is to work poetry, chanting and talking, after Ma Xisheng inherited the throne, he simply resigned from all his positions in the court and became a monk.

When Ma Yin died, he not only passed the throne to Ma Xisheng, but also left a profound rule, that is, he hoped that Ma Xisheng could pass the throne to his younger brothers when he passed on the throne.

For this reason, Ma Yin also put a sword in the ancestral hall of the Ma family, and had the following last words:

Whoever disobeys my will kill him with this sword.

Ma Xifan, the third generation of kings of Southern Chu, has always been very angry about Ma Xisheng's assumption of the throne at the beginning, he thinks that his father is unfair, and thinks that Ma Xisheng's mother Concubine De is the obstruction from it, which made him the king of Chu for so many years, so after he ascended the throne, he was very unfriendly to the descendants of Ma Xisheng's lineage.

Ma Xisheng's mother, Concubine De, Ma Xifan was very rude to her, her food and clothing were reduced in various ways, and she was not usually thoughtful in taking care of her, Ma Xisheng's half-brother Ma Xiwang, Ma Xifan did not treat him and blamed him a lot.

The two of them were excluded and suppressed by Ma Xifan all day long, became angry and became ill, and died soon after.

Her struggle was silent

(Nanchu Ma Xifan image)

People in high positions often have an unusually sensitive sensitivity to power, afraid of ministers making trouble, afraid of relatives rebelling, especially those like Ma Xifan who have many brothers and sisters, he must strictly guard against it.

Ma Xifan also has a younger brother, whose name is Ma Xigao, who is honest and honest, capable of doing things, and has a good reputation, and a colleague named Pei Renxu has a holiday with Ma Xigao, so he ran to Ma Xifan to slander Ma Xigao, Ma Xifan listened to and believed it, and became suspicious of Ma Xigao's capable subordinates.

When Ma Xifan ascended the throne, the five dynasties were still the Later Tang Dynasty, and after he ascended the throne for a period of time, the Later Tang Dynasty perished, and the five dynasties carried out the third regime of the Later Jin.

The Later Jin regime, threatened by the Khitans, could only be said to be powerless for these fragmented secession regimes in the Central Plains, so it had to generally adopt a policy of friendship and special sealing for the secession warlords, and Ma Xifan of Southern Chu also received a lot of rewards.

Southern Chu was already wealthy, and Ma Xifan could get a lot of economic help from the Later Jin Dynasty, but he was still not satisfied, and often increased various harsh taxes and miscellaneous taxes on the local government.

Peng Shichou and Ma Xifan originally had contradictions, but Peng Shichou's cousin Peng was Ma Xifan's wife, and there was this relationship before, and the contradiction between the two was eased, and later Peng died, and the contradiction between Peng and Ma broke out completely, and it turned into a war.
